As some may have read, myself and Paypal have been having some issues recently. We are on the shortlist to appear on the Jeremy Kyle show to see if we can sort out our differences by shouting at each other but thats a different matter.

My account was limited last week and a hold placed on my funds for 180 days. The only thing I can do with my account is refund payments made to me.

Im thinking that I could refund some buyers who have bought parts off me and had them delivered already then have them repay the money back into my merchant account?

The risk is that I might never see some of the refunded cash again

I could wait the 6 months and withdraw it but the fact that Paypal are earning interest off my money boils my pi$$

Obviously Id need the help and co-operation of some of my buyers from Scoobynet.

Id be interested to hear what others would do?
